Description: Popkit is a creative software for designing pop-up cards and paper crafts. It has an intuitive drag-and-drop interface for adding customizable templates, images, text, and stickers to create unique 3D paper art.

Description: Cue is a smart calendar app that helps you plan and manage your schedule more effectively. It uses AI to analyze your events, tasks, and habits to provide intelligent suggestions to optimize your time.
